From: fomichev Date: Fri, 4 Jul 2025 13:46:04 +0000 (+0300) Subject: Другие правки ошибок - разрешение на редактирование X-Git-Url: https://gitweb.erp-flowers.ru/?a=commitdiff_plain;h=47b6828e90d9ec5fa1b4f10211e86ca01995880a;p=erp24_rep%2Fyii-erp24%2F.git Другие правки ошибок - разрешение на редактирование --- diff --git a/erp24/controllers/CategoryPlanController.php b/erp24/controllers/CategoryPlanController.php index c9f47be3..b3350bbe 100644 --- a/erp24/controllers/CategoryPlanController.php +++ b/erp24/controllers/CategoryPlanController.php @@ -50,9 +50,12 @@ class CategoryPlanController extends Controller { $model->load(Yii::$app->request->get()); $service = new AutoPlannogrammaService(); - $isEditable = date($model->year . '-' . $model->month . '-d') > date('Y-m-d') && ( - (date('d') < 27) || (date('Y-m-d', strtotime('-2 month', strtotime(date($model->year . '-' . $model->month . '-d')))) > date('Y-m-d'))); - //$isEditable = true; + $deadline = date( + 'Y-m-d', + strtotime("{$model->year}-{$model->month}-27 -2 months") + ); + $isEditable = date('Y-m-d') < $deadline; + $categoryPlan = CategoryPlan::find()->where(['year' => $model->year, 'month' => $model->month, 'store_id' => $model->store_id])->indexBy('category')->asArray()->all(); $types = []; $table = [];